Charles L. Carlin, Jr., Greenville (Perry Twp.) passed away 6:15 am on Sunday, August 20, 2017 at the Villa’s at St. Paul’s Home, Greenville. He was 83.
Born in Pittsburgh on April 21, 1934 a son of the late Charles L. and Bernadette (Firlie) Carlin, Sr. He had been a driver for the George Junior Republic, Grove City. He was a member of the Northwest Pennsylvania Steam Engine and Old Equipment Association and the Portersville Steam Show. He enjoyed woodworking in his shop and the companionship of his dog “Buddy”.
